SENIOR RECORD THE ambition of every student of the class of 1944 has been achieved. We are graduating. Throughout our four years in high school, we have striven for honors. In athletics, we have won these honors by having championship teams. We have had three members of our class who have won life memberships in the California Scholarship Federation. We have enjoyed activities, one of which has been that of the Student council, which has helped form the policies of the school. We started our Freshman year by taking our initiation well. In our Sophomore year we began to take part in school activities. Students who were eligible joined clubs. Our dramatic ability was shown in the success of the Sophomore Variety Show. As the year advanced, we became attuned to the rhythm of an active school. Eliciting praise from the audience, we gave as our Junior Play, Slippery When Wetf' Even during our Senior year, exclamations of delight are still being heard about the beauty of the Springtime Theme in the decorations for J unior-Senior Banquet held at Lakewood Club in Long Beach, the evening 'of June 22, 1943. The decorations featured were Wishing Wells covered with colored flowers. In our last year we presented a Senior Play; we were hosts to the J uniors at the May Breakfast, and guests of the Juniors at the Junior- Senior Banquet. To represent the qualities that the senior class admires, we chose two students, Pat Grant and J ohn Lawder. Upon graduating, the boys face things that they have not planned. Most of them are entering the service. The girls also face a future that is disturbed. But the training and education we have received in our high school years has prepared us for the future. WILMA MARTIN, Senior Representative.
